Red Barn Nature Series!
This new nature program will take place on Thursdays at 6:30pm at the "red barn" at Fidler Pond Park. Connect with nature, take in the serenity of this venue, enhance your knowledge, connect with others and have some good old fashioned outdoor fun! On Thursday, September 3rd, Nancy Brown will be speaking about Fidler Pond. She will explain its geological background and the rich mineral deposits that led to its excavation, along with giving a little history on its life as a gravel pit. She will then discuss its current role as a recreational park and wildlife habitat (and what types of critters people can find there!)
